NEUROLOGICAL DISORDERS

QuestionAnswer
COMMON CAUSES OF ALZHEIMER'S DISEASE INCLUDE: UNKNOWN = AMYLOID PLAQUES & NEUROFIBRILLARY TANGLES ARE SEEN IN AUTOPSY
BRAIN DAMAGE R/T CEREBROVASCULAR & CARDIO-VASCULAR PROBLEMS (USUALLY STROKE), CEREBRAL BLOOD VESSEL DAMAGE R/T GENTEICS, ENDOCARDITIS, MYELOID ANGIOPATHY, VASCULITIS,& PROFOUND HYPOTENSION ALL CONTRIBUTE TO WHICH TYPE OF DEMENTIA ? VASCULAR DEMENTIA , THE 2ND MOST COMMON CAUSE OF DEMENTIA
WHAT CAUSES LEWY BODY DEMENTIA UNKNOWN, BUT FAMIAL CASES HAVE BEEN REPORTED
FRONTOTEMPORAL DEMENTIA IS LINKED WITH WHAT POSSIBLE CAUSE ? ABNORMAL TAU PROTEINS BUILT UP IN NEUROFIBRILLARY TANGLES = FRONTAL & TEMPORAL LOBES
WHAT ARE THE S/S OF STAGE I ALZHEIMER'S DISEASE ? ........P1619 APPEARS HEALTHY & ALERT; RESTLESS, FORGETFUL OR UNCOORDINATED; DISORIENTED TO TIME & DATE; PROBLEMS W/SIMPLE CALCULATIONS
THE S/S OF STAGE II ALZHEIMER'S DISEASE ? WANDERIING, PERIODS OF LUCIDITY, SUNDOWNING, LANGUAGE DEFICITS, APRAXIA
WHAT IS PARAPHASIA USING THE WRONG WORD
WHAT IS ECHOLALIA REPITITION OF WORDS OR PHRASES
SCANNING SPEECH? SEARCHING FOR WORDS
APHASIA? ABSCENCE OF SPEECH
APRAXIA? INABILITY TO PERFORM PURPOSEFUL MVMTS & USE OBJECTS CORRECTLY
WHAT SENSORIMOTOR DEFICITS ARE SEEN IN STAGE 2 ALZHEIMER'S? .........P1620 APRAXIA,ASTEREOGNOSIS (INABILITY TO IDENTIFY OBJECTS BY TOUCH), AGRAPHIA
WHAT ARE THE S/S OIF STAGE 3 ALZHEIMER'S DISEASE? INCONTINENCE, FALLS, DELUSIONS, PARANOIA, ANOREXIA,
HOW IS ALZHEIMERS DIAGNOSED RULE OUT ANY OTHER POSSIBILITIES
WHAT DO YOU RULE OUT WHEN SEEING A POTENTIAL ALZHEIMER'S PATIENT? OD, INFX, HYPOTHYROID, DEHYDRATION, HEART DISEASE, STROKE, COPD,
A DIAGNOSIS OF ALZHEIMER'S REQUIRES WHAT 3 ELEMENTS? DOCUMENTED PRESENCE OF DEMENTIA W/ONSET B/W 40 & 90 YRS OLD, NO LOSS OF CONSCIOUSNESS & ABSCENCE OF SYSTEMIC OR BRAIN DISORDER THAT COULD CAUSE MENTAL CHGS
WHAT ARE SOME Rx USED TO TREAT AD ? COGNEX(TACRINE), ARICEPT (DONEPEZIL), EXELON (RIVASTIGMINE),(PARASYMPATHOMIMETICS)
WHICH Rx IS INDICATED FOR MODERATE TO SEVERE AD & VASCULAR DEMENTIA ? NAMENDA (MEMANTINE)
Rx USED FOR SEVERE agitation in ad are ? thioridazine (melaril), or haloperidol (haldol)
what are the 4 classifications of MS ? relaspsing - remitting; primary progressive; secondary progressive; & progressive relapsing
how is MS diagnosed ? .......p1627 MRI w/findings of lesions is most definitive test; also CSF analysis for elevated IGg, ct scan = enlrgd ventricles , atrophy & white matter lesions; areas of chgs in glucose metabolism from PET scan,
in which systems would you expect to see delayed conduction from evoked response testing ? visual, auditory or somatosensory
why are ACTH & glucocorticoid Tx used in MS ? to decrease inflammation & suppress the immune system
